Nigerian-born artist, BJ Sam, has unveiled his new single, “Kombo na Yesu,” a vibrant fusion of Congolese rhythms and contemporary worship that is rapidly attracting global attention.
Released worldwide, the track stands out for its uplifting energy and rich multicultural foundation. BJ Sam weaves Lingala, French, and English into the song—an intentional move aimed at reaching a broader international audience and celebrating Africa’s linguistic diversity.
The single carries a powerful message centered on the victory of Jesus over death, delivering themes of hope, joy, and spiritual renewal. Its impact is already extending beyond the African continent, with the music video currently airing on major international platforms such as TBN UK and TRACE TV.
The release follows a notable milestone in BJ Sam’s career. His previous work, “Don’t Worry Everything Will Be Fine,” was invited for submission by the Recording Academy (GRAMMY Awards) and subsequently appeared on the official GRAMMY voting ballot in the Global Performance category—an achievement that underscores his rising global profile.
BJ Sam’s music career has long been defined by cross-cultural expression and worldwide collaboration. His unique blend of African rhythmic heritage and Western melodic influences has earned him recognition as an emerging voice in contemporary world music. He first gained international visibility when his track “Mon Amour” was featured in the Hollywood film Heart of Fatness (2017), drawing additional interest from the global network TV5Monde.
In recent years, he has led major multinational projects, including the worldwide Christmas collaboration “Merry Christmas” (2022) and the global peace anthem “Show Some Love” (2023), which brought together artists from every continent. These initiatives reflect BJ Sam’s ongoing commitment to fostering unity, positivity, and cultural connection through music.
With “Kombo na Yesu,” BJ Sam continues to strengthen his mission of building musical bridges between Africa and the world, offering listeners an inspiring and globally resonant sound.
